Michigan HB4853 proposes a tax credit for teachers and administrators who spend on classroom supplies.
Michigan HB4853 amends the state's tax code to allow teachers and administrators to claim a credit for 50% of their classroom supply expenses, up to $2,000 for individual filers and $4,000 for joint filers. The credit applies to supplies like books, computer programs, art materials, and other educational items. If the credit exceeds the taxpayer's liability, the excess cannot be refunded. The bill defines terms such as "administrator," "classroom supplies," "school," and "teacher.
